What Causes Ecosia to Go Down?
Several factors can contribute to Ecosia's downtime. Here are some common reasons:
- Server Maintenance: Regular maintenance is necessary to ensure the smooth operation of any online service, including Ecosia.
- Technical Glitches: Unexpected technical issues can cause temporary outages.
- High Traffic Volumes: Surges in user traffic can overwhelm servers, leading to slowdowns or outages.
- Network Problems: Connectivity issues can affect access to the Ecosia platform.

What Should You Do When Ecosia is Down?
When you find that Ecosia is down, there are several steps you can take:
- Check Social Media: Ecosia often updates their users on outages via their official social media accounts.
- Try Alternative Search Engines: Utilize other search engines like Google or DuckDuckGo while waiting for Ecosia to come back online.
- Wait and Retry: Sometimes, the best option is to wait a few minutes and try again.

What Alternatives Can You Use When Ecosia is Down?
If Ecosia is down, several alternative search engines can serve your needs:
- Google: The most popular search engine with extensive features.
- DuckDuckGo: Focuses on user privacy and does not track searches.
- Bing: Microsoft's search engine with unique features and perks.
- StartPage: Offers Google search results without tracking user data.
What is the Impact of Ecosia's Downtime on Environmental Initiatives?
The impact of Ecosia being down extends beyond user inconvenience. Ecosia is known for its commitment to environmental initiatives, specifically tree planting. When the service is down, users are unable to contribute to these efforts temporarily. This can lead to:
- Reduced Funding: Less ad revenue during downtime means fewer funds for tree planting.
- User Frustration: Users may feel disconnected from their environmental contributions.
